How much do data capture j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for data capture in Wisconsin is $27.23,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.49 and $43.41 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some typical challenges faced by data capture professionals, and how are they addressed?

Data Capture professionals often encounter challenges such as handling large volumes of information, maintaining accuracy under tight deadlines, and adapting to frequent updates in data formats or software systems. To address these challenges, companies provide thorough training, maintain clear data entry protocols, and sometimes implement automated quality checks to help ensure data integrity. Collaboration with IT and data management teams is common, allowing Data Capture specialists to resolve any technical issues quickly. By staying organized, communicating effectively, and using available tools, professionals in this role can consistently meet performance expectations and maintain high data quality.

Is data capturing a difficult job?

Data capturing is generally considered a straightforward job that requires attention to detail, accuracy, and familiarity with data entry tools or software. The difficulty level depends on the complexity of the data and the volume to be processed, but it typically involves repetitive tasks that can be learned with training. Strong organizational skills and focus are important for success in this role.

What is a data capture?

A Data Capture job involves collecting, inputting, and managing data from various sources into digital systems. This role ensures accuracy, completeness, and organization of data for business use. Responsibilities may include data entry, verification, and quality control. Data Capture professionals work with databases, spreadsheets, or specialized software to maintain records efficiently. Attention to detail and strong typing skills are essential for success in this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in data capture,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Data Capture professional, you need strong attention to detail, fast and accurate data entry skills, and a high school diploma or equivalent educational background. Familiarity with data management software such as Microsoft Excel, Google Sheets, or specialized database platforms is often required, and some employers may prefer experience with document scanning tools or OCR technology. Reliability, organization, and the ability to maintain confidentiality are standout soft skills in this position. These capabilities ensure the integrity and accuracy of collected data, which supports informed business decisions and operational efficiency.

The Position:

The Therapy Care Specialist will work with SoleoRx TCMC model and utilize national and local resources to facilitate high quality care of a patient with specialty pharmacy needs. The Therapy Care Specialist will work under the supervision of a Pharmacist to oversee logistics of a patient’s dispense and prescription maintenance, assessment data capture, and serves as the point person to coordinate patient care across all layers of the patient care continuum while on service with Soleo Health. Responsibilities include:

  • Act as single point of contact for specialty patients and as liaison with Soleo branch personnel to coordinate timely medication dispense and delivery
  • Works under supervision of specialty pharmacist and/or branch pharmacist to capture assessment data, ascertain patients supply needs, and schedule new and refill medication deliveries
  • Run daily and weekly pharmacy reports as needed
  • Answer phones and warm transfer call to appropriate location, monitor incoming faxes, and monitor TCMC refill queues
  • Send orders to physicians for signature
  • Work with intake/reimbursement staff to maintain active patient insurance coverage and actively pursue authorizations and re-authorizations with the auth/billing staff at the branch level
  • Documentation of all patient interaction and care coordination in the designated system of record for clear and consistent communication
  • Complete therapy specific training as required
